Abstract
The present invention relates to Akkermansia muciniphila or fragments thereof for treating a metabolic disorder in a subject in need thereof. The present invention also relates to a composition, a pharmaceutical composition and a medicament comprising Akkermansia muciniphila or fragments thereof for treating a metabolic disorder. The present invention also relates to the use of Akkermansia muciniphila or fragments thereof for promoting weight loss in a subject in need thereof.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1 - 17 . (canceled)
18 . A method for treating a metabolic disorder in a subject in need thereof, comprising administering to the subject Akkermansia muciniphila or fragments thereof.
19 . The method according to claim 18 , wherein said metabolic disorder is obesity.
20 . The method according to claim 18 , wherein said metabolic disorder is selected from the group consisting of metabolic syndrome, insulin-deficiency or insulin-resistance related disorders, Diabetes Mellitus, glucose intolerance, abnormal lipid metabolism, atherosclerosis, hypertension, cardiac pathology, stroke, non-alcoholic fatty liver disease, hyperglycemia, hepatic steatosis, dyslipidemia, dysfunction of the immune system associated with overweight and obesity, cardiovascular diseases, high cholesterol, elevated triglycerides, asthma, sleep apnoea, osteoarthritis, neuro-degeneration, gallbladder disease, syndrome X, inflammatory and immune disorders, atherogenic dyslipidemia and cancer.
21 . The method according to claim 18 , wherein viable cells of Akkermansia muciniphila are administered to the subject in need thereof.
22 . The method according to claim 18 , wherein Akkermansia muciniphila or fragments thereof are orally administered.
23 . The method according to claim 18 , wherein an amount of Akkermansia muciniphila ranging from about 1·10 4 to about 1·10 12 cfu is administered to the subject.
24 . The method according to claim 18 , wherein Akkermansia muciniphila or fragments thereof are administered at least three times a week.
25 . The method according to claim 18 , wherein Akkermansia muciniphila or fragments thereof are co-administered with another probiotic strain and/or with one or more prebiotics.
26 . A method for increasing energy expenditure or for increasing satiety or for promoting weight loss in a subject, comprising administering Akkermansia muciniphila or fragments thereof to the subject.
27 . The method according to claim 26 , wherein said method does not impact the food intake of said subject.
28 . The method according to claim 26 , wherein viable cells of Akkermansia muciniphila are administered to the subject in need thereof.
29 . The method according to claim 26 , wherein Akkermansia muciniphila or fragments thereof are orally administered.
30 . The method according to claim 26 , wherein an amount of Akkermansia muciniphila ranging from about 1·10 4 to about 1·10 12 cfu is administered to the subject.
31 . The method according to claim 26 , wherein Akkermansia muciniphila or fragments thereof are administered at least three times a week.
32 . The method according to claim 26 , wherein Akkermansia muciniphila or fragments thereof are co-administered with another probiotic strain and/or with one or more prebiotics.
